Another notable feature of cast iron flat pans is their durability. When properly cared for, these pans can last a lifetime, or even longer. Unlike non-stick options that may wear out or scratch over time, cast iron is virtually indestructible. This longevity makes them a fantastic investment for any kitchen. Additionally, their ability to develop a natural non-stick surface through seasoning only enhances their usability over time.

In addition to enhancing the cooking process, the bacon press can significantly reduce cooking time. Bacon cooks faster when it’s evenly flattened, allowing for a more efficient breakfast experience. This is particularly beneficial for those who like to prepare larger batches of bacon for family gatherings or meal prep. With a bacon press in hand, you can say goodbye to unevenly cooked strips that leave some pieces burnt and others undercooked.

  • On average, the cost of prefab steel buildings can range from $10 to $30 per square foot, depending on the factors described above. Basic structures intended for simple purposes, such as storage facilities, may be closer to the lower end of that range. In contrast, more complex, multi-purpose buildings designed for commercial use could reach the higher end or even exceed it, particularly when customization is involved.

  • One of the most significant benefits of steel shed offices is their structural integrity. Steel is known for its strength and durability, making it resistant to adverse weather conditions, pests, and fire. Unlike traditional wooden structures, steel doesn’t warp, crack, or rot over time, ensuring that your workspace remains safe and secure for many years. This robustness contributes to lower long-term maintenance costs, as the materials used are less prone to wear and tear.

  • Historically, the first airline hangars were simplistic structures designed primarily for storage. Early 20th-century aviation saw rudimentary wooden buildings that lacked insulation and modern conveniences. However, as aviation technology progressed during and after World War II, the need for more sophisticated hangar designs became evident. The introduction of metal structures provided enhanced durability and security, allowing for the housing of larger, more advanced aircraft.


  • A 12x20 metal garage kit is a prefabricated structure designed for versatile usage, made from durable metal materials, typically galvanized steel. The dimensions of 12 feet by 20 feet cater to a range of storage needs, providing an area that is spacious yet compact enough for residential spaces. These kits come with all the necessary components, including panels, supports, and doors, allowing for easy assembly.

  • Cost-effectiveness is another significant advantage of metal farm buildings. Although the initial investment may be higher than that of wood, the long-term savings on maintenance and repair costs are substantial. Metal buildings do not require regular treatments for pests or rot, and their long lifespan can exceed 50 years with minimal upkeep. Additionally, many manufacturers offer pre-engineered building systems, which can reduce labor costs and construction time. Farmers can quickly erect these structures and get back to their primary operations.


  • The size of the metal shed is another key factor influencing its cost. Generally, metal sheds are available in various sizes ranging from small (6x8 feet) to large (12x20 feet or more). Larger sheds naturally cost more due to the additional materials and labor needed for their construction. Before making a decision, consider what you intend to store or work on in your shed. A well-planned design will not only save you money but also prevent overspending on unnecessary space.
